
Safety Guidelines
Keeping our student community safe and respectful.
Verified students only
Every uSWAP member must sign up with a valid .edu email address. This ensures you're swapping with real students from your campus community.
Meet safely
For in-person swaps, meet in public campus spaces — libraries, student centers, or common areas. Let a friend know where you're going and when. Trust your instincts.
Be respectful
Treat every swap partner with kindness and respect. Clear communication is key — set expectations upfront, be on time, and honor your commitments.
Report concerns
If something doesn't feel right — a misleading profile, inappropriate behavior, or an academic integrity issue — report it immediately to hellouswap.app@gmail.com. We take every report seriously.
Not allowed on uSWAP
- •Ghostwriting, cheating, or anything that violates academic integrity
- •Commercial services or paid offerings
- •Harassment, discrimination, or any form of abuse
- •Sharing personal contact info publicly in listings
